Description

The Kabbalah is an esoteric Jewish doctrine adapted by author S.L.

MacGregor Mathers to form the Hermetic order of the Golden Dawn, an occult organisation.

This volume includes three of the critical books from the Zohar, the fundamental work in Kabbalah, as well as Mathers' introduction explaining the key elements of Jewish mysticism.

Mathers' translation from Hebrew originally appeared in 1926, and it continues to be a valuable resource for students interested in Religious Studies, particularly Mysticism and the Occult.
